A good local breakfast spot is one of my favorite things in life. I like waking up and cooking bacon, eggs and potatoes for myself, but what's better than having someone else do that for you while you relax in a booth while reading the morning news? This is what I needed on this particular Saturday in Eldridge, and this is what I got from Tasty Cafe.
The building in which Tasty Cafe resides is pretty unassuming and easy to miss. It looks clean and new from the outside but also has a really low profile. On this Saturday morning, however, it wasn't hard to spot. As I neared the restaurant traveling west along Le Claire Road, it was easy to tell the parking lot was packed. I got a little excited - this place must be really popular to be this full!
And indeed it was. As I approached the entrance, I literally became the line out the door waiting to get in for a table. Only for a moment, though, as the staff quickly cleared a few tables and I was seated in a booth about three minutes later.
I quickly had a drink order in and a menu in front of me. As I typically do, I ended up ordering a skillet - I think the title was Ay Caramba, or something (it was a Mexican Skillet with chorizo). The servers were really nice and with my order placed, I sat back with some reddit on my phone to enjoy my morning.
The interior of Tasty Cafe is much the same as many other newer breakfast nooks I've been to recently. The interior appears to have been redone recently - the floors are a clean looking grey/brown ceramic tile, the walls are a very neutral light blue, and the overhead is covered in a simple drop ceiling with florescent lighting throughout. It's all very clean and reminiscent of many other breakfast diners.
My food arrived not long after ordering and I tucked in soon after. The scrambled eggs were a little less fluffy than I'd have expected, but were still soft and buttery and paired well with the rye toast I'd gotten with the skillet. With the eggs completed, I tucked into the skillet contents underneath. These were similarly solid - the chorizo had some nice spice to it, the home fries were crispy on the outside and fluffy within, and the vegetables throughout were sufficiently cooked but still retained plenty of sweetness and texture. All in all, a great way to start this lazy Saturday.
If I were back in Eldridge again, I'd come back here for more breakfast. For that matter, I'd come back to try their lunch options, as well. Everything looks tasty, the servers were really nice, and the interior is clean. Thanks, Tasty Cafe!
